Output 3b8df65f49c62612fb0d24e30e4bdef3c1f9550a629307a35654bdd545e29776:5

value
65906588936
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66dedd6ca40ff5a58cf676ad66b273965974196b OP_EQUALVERIFY OP_CHECKSIG
address
LUbtAhy6AdCZtgokDrfDBo94AxkQ2Y7b9u
transaction
3b8df65f49c62612fb0d24e30e4bdef3c1f9550a629307a35654bdd545e29776
spent
true